The Everyday Life Situations That Lead to Spinal Stress
Modern life places a tremendous amount of strain on the spine. Many people spend hours sitting at desks, working on laptops, looking down at phones, or driving long distances. Even activities that seem harmless can gradually create stress within the spinal joints.
Think about a typical day. You might wake up feeling stiff in your neck. During the workday, you sit for long stretches without moving much. By the afternoon, your shoulders may feel tight and your lower back begins to ache.
Later in the evening, you relax on the couch or scroll through your phone. While these habits may feel normal, they often lead to poor posture that places additional pressure on the spine.
Over time, this repeated stress can cause small misalignments in the spinal joints. When these joints are not moving properly, surrounding muscles may tighten and nerves can become irritated.
This can lead to a wide variety of symptoms, including neck stiffness, back pain, headaches, shoulder tension, reduced mobility, and even fatigue.
Many people try to stretch more or improve their posture, but if the spinal joints themselves are not functioning correctly, the discomfort often continues.

What Makes the Pro-Adjuster Different
The Pro-Adjuster 360 System is a sophisticated instrument that allows chiropractors to analyze and adjust the spine with remarkable precision.
Instead of using manual force, the device uses a gentle tapping motion to deliver targeted adjustments to specific areas of the spine.
One of the most unique aspects of the system is that it also measures how each spinal segment responds to movement. This provides real-time feedback that helps identify areas where joints may not be functioning properly.
Because the adjustments are delivered with controlled precision, the treatment is extremely comfortable for most patients.
Many people are surprised by how gentle the experience feels compared to what they expected from chiropractic care.
This makes the Pro-Adjuster 360 System especially appealing for individuals who may feel nervous about traditional adjustments.

Why Precision Makes a Big Difference
One of the biggest advantages of instrument chiropractic care is accuracy.
The spine contains dozens of joints that must work together for proper movement. When just one or two of these joints lose mobility, it can create a chain reaction throughout the body.
Precision adjustments help restore motion exactly where it is needed without affecting surrounding structures unnecessarily.
This targeted approach allows the body to begin correcting imbalances more efficiently.
Many patients report that they feel improvements in mobility and comfort as their spinal function gradually improves.
The Connection Between Spinal Health and Daily Comfort
Spinal health plays a much larger role in overall wellbeing than many people realize.
When the spine is functioning properly, the body is able to move freely and comfortably. Nerves communicate more effectively with muscles and organs, allowing systems throughout the body to operate smoothly.
However, when spinal joints become restricted or misaligned, the body often compensates in ways that create additional stress.
Muscles may tighten to protect the affected area. Posture may change to avoid discomfort. Over time, these compensations can lead to additional pain in the neck, shoulders, hips, or lower back.
By restoring proper joint motion, chiropractic care helps the body return to its natural balance.
